Orange Peel Drywall Texture

During the 1980's and very early 1990's orange skin drywall texture was very common in new residential structure across the Southwest United States. During the 1990's and early on 2000's, hand textures such as militarist and trowel, skip trowel, or santa atomic number 26, became much more popular. Now you very rarely meet orange skin texture used in new construction in the Southwest Us, however it seems to have made a resurgence in other parts of the country. Orange peel texture is often found in hotels or big commercial buildings. Spray knockdown texture is slightly more mutual than orange skin even in those types of buildings.

Is it Orange Peel Texture or Knockdown?

Some people error knockdown for orange peel texture. How can yous tell the divergence? Both orangish pare texture and knockdown are sprayed using like equipment. Withal, every bit described beneath, orangish peel is thinner and left to dry out immediately after existence sprayed. Knockdown, on the other paw is, smoothed slightly, or "knocked-down", with a large flat knife shortly afterward being sprayed. The globules of mud with knockdown are larger than orangish pare and spread out across the surface. Orange peel covers the entire surface of drywall with a sparse layer and so the underlying drywall does non testify through. With knockdown however, very small areas of exposed drywall are visible between the globules of sprayed drywall mud.

How to Employ Orange Skin Texture

Picture of orange peel texture on drywallOrangish peel texture is very similar to Spray/splatter knockdown. Texture mud is pumped through a long hose to a special spray nozzle. Running parallel to the mud hose is a high pressure air line. In the spray nozzle the air and mud combine causing texture mud to splatter into thousands of small droplets. These droplets of drywall mud state on walls and gradually merge to course a consistent thin layer of mud beyond the surface. Equally the texture mud dries, it resembles the peel of an orange, thus the name.

When spraying orangish peel texture, the tip is smaller than what is used for knockdown and the air pressure level is slightly higher. This makes the aerosol of mud exiting the nozzle smaller than knockdown texture, assuasive them to merge into a uniform film rather than remaining every bit individual globules.

The most hard challenge of spraying orange skin texture is keeping information technology consistent beyond the entire surface. Spraying an even orange peel texture is in many ways more difficult than spraying knockdown. The technique required is similar to spraying paint on walls. Still, when spraying pigment with an airless sprayer, you ordinarily also back ringlet the surface to smooth out any uneven areas. With orangish peel texture, you do not have this option since the texture must be left to dry in identify.

Photo of orange peel drywall textureAfter information technology has been sprayed, orangish skin texture is left to dry as is. Because of this, information technology is slightly quicker to use than knockdown. This is likely a big reason it is more than common in hotels and large commercial applications where reducing labor costs is increasingly important. After it has thoroughly stale , information technology tin can be primed and painted every bit normal.

Orangish Skin Spray Equipment

Spray Texture Rigs

Spray rigs are used by the professionals for the largest of jobs. For case, when spraying orange peel in hotels, hospitals, or other large commercial buildings, it is necessary to use a large spray rig with a capacity of 200 or more than gallons. This blazon of spray rig is commonly mounted on a trailer with a gas powered motor and air compressor. The texture mud used comes in powdered class and is mixed in the hopper similar to the way mortar mixers work.

Portable texture sprayers

Portable sprayers with tanks that can hold between 5 and 10 gallons of texture are useful for smaller projects where you need to spray at least a few rooms. Graco® makes several different models of sprayer with different size tanks and motors. These sprayers are a good selection for professionals, even as a supplement to a large spray rig. These smaller sprayers are great when yous don't desire to fire up the big trailer mounted sprayer for a simple patch or pocket-sized project.

Hand held spray hoppers

Photo of a knockdown hopper used to spray small knockdown texture patches

Hoppers are lightweight and easy to operate. They can be used by practise information technology yourself homeowners to repair small patches. Since the mud is gravity fed to the nozzle rather than pumped under pressure, information technology is difficult to become the same texture effect as with larger sprayers or spray rigs. Some professionals take establish success spraying orange peel with a hopper past using very thin mud.

Spray texture in a can

Homax® sells drywall texture spray cans that work just like virtually aerosol cans. You lot can buy them specifically for knockdown or orange pare texture. Though they are convenient for small patches or repairs, information technology is very hard if not impossible to friction match the original texture using this method. If used, they are primarily for small patches. You should always examination the texture on a scrap slice of drywall before spraying the patch.

Soft bristle castor and paint stick

When it comes time to match texture on drywall repairs, most professionals simply pull out their small air compressor and hopper. Nevertheless, if the patch is very small, a few inches in diameter, you may exist able to match orange peel texture with a soft bristle castor and a paint stick. If you take e'er pulled your fingers across a wet toothbrush, you are familiar with how it splatters water in the contrary direction. Similarly, a soft bristle brush can exist used to splatter thin mud on a drywall patch. To do this, the mud must be very thin, near watery. The castor is then dipped in the mud and a modest stick tin can be used to pull the bristles toward y'all, in the opposite management of the patch. As the bristles spring dorsum into place, they splatter mud in the contrary direction.

Should it be used in new construction

Whether or not orangish peel texture should exist used in new construction depends on several factors. However, it is expert to remember that orange peel texture is very difficult to match. Similar all sprayed textures, the final product depends on the consistency of the mud, the ambience temperature and humidity levels, the air pressure level used, and of form the skill of the tradesman. It is almost impossible to recreate conditions exactly like they were when the original texture was applied. Though orange peel texture may be highly-seasoned for it's quickness of application and apparent power to cover underlying imperfections. The ease of matching this type of texture in the future should be given consideration. Especially in areas that get a lot of traffic or are subject area to updates and repairs.
